UML women’s basketball team blows out Maine Fort Kent, 82-36

Summary by The Sun (Lowell)
With four River Hawks finishing in double figures, the UMass Lowell women’s basketball team turned in a complete effort on Sunday afternoon, powering past Maine Fort Kent, 82–36, at the Kennedy Family Athletic Complex in Lowell.
